Meaning
RFID antennas are specialized devices designed to emit and receive radio waves used for communicating with RFID tags. These antennas are responsible for transmitting and receiving data, enabling seamless identification, tracking, and management of assets, products, and people. The RFID antenna market encompasses a wide range of antenna types, including linear polarized, circular polarized, and near-field antennas, each catering to specific application requirements.

Market Restraints
Despite the numerous advantages of RFID antennas, there are certain challenges that hinder market growth.
- High Implementation Costs: The initial investment required for deploying RFID systems, including antennas, can be substantial, especially for small and medium-sized enterprises. This cost factor acts as a restraint for companies with limited budgets, limiting the adoption of RFID technology.
- Privacy and Security Concerns: As RFID technology becomes more pervasive, concerns about data privacy and security arise. The potential for unauthorized access to sensitive information through RFID systems poses a challenge for organizations, leading to hesitancy in adopting RFID solutions.
- Limited Read Range in Certain Environments: Some environments, such as those with high metal or liquid content, can interfere with the radio frequency signals emitted by RFID antennas, resulting in limited read range or inaccuracies. This limitation may hinder the widespread adoption of RFID systems in specific applications.

Category-wise Insights
- Linear Polarized Antennas: Linear polarized antennas are widely used in applications that require longer read ranges and directional coverage. These antennas are commonly employed in logistics and transportation sectors for inventory tracking and container management.
- Circular Polarized Antennas: Circular polarized antennas provide a wider reading area and are suitable for applications where tag orientation is uncertain. These antennas find applications in retail environments, asset tracking, and access control systems.
- Near-Field Antennas: Near-field antennas are designed for short-range communication and are typically used in applications such as access control, ticketing, and healthcare. These antennas offer high reading accuracy and are capable of reading multiple tags simultaneously.

Market Key Trends
- Integration of RFID with IoT: The integration of RFID technology with IoT platforms enables seamless data communication and analysis, leading to advanced supply chain management, smart retail, and predictive maintenance.
- Miniaturization of Antennas: The trend towards smaller, more compact RFID antennas allows for their integration into various devices and applications, expanding the potential use cases for RFID technology.
- Focus on Data Analytics: With the increasing volume of data generated by RFID systems, there is a growing focus on leveraging data analytics and machine learning techniques to extract valuable insights and optimize business processes.
- Development of Printable Antennas: The development of printable RFID antennas using flexible and cost-effective materials allows for easy integration into packaging and labels, opening up new opportunities in areas such as smart packaging and product authentication.
